Jaejoong talked about the nuisance behavior of private fans (Sasenpen: fans who follow celebrities' private lives). In the recently released web variety show "Jetching," Jaejoong had a talk with THE BOYZ's Young Hoon. On this day, Young Hoon said, "I'm really worried. Brother, you were really badly affected by private fans, right?" Jaejoong looked back and said, "It was really bad. Back in the days of H.O.T., fans were analog, and they acted on everything. We were in an era where analog and digital coexisted, so it felt even worse." Young Hoon then mentioned, "I often saw it on the news when I was young. Articles like 'Intrusion into TVXQ's dormitory'." Jaejoong conveyed, "It's natural for them to come into the house, there are private taxis everywhere I go. But this is a very weak level." Jaejoong then confessed an episode, "When I was at home, I received a photo from an unknown number. The photo showed my back at that moment. They were just there. When I noticed, it was already too late, and they were gone." He continued, "There was also a private fan who kissed me while I was sleeping. That person was caught at the dormitory. If it happened now, they would have gone to prison. That's why I always look around and check for anything out of the ordinary." Due to such incidents, he expressed gratitude to IU. He said, "I am grateful to IU. IU sued people who crossed the line (malicious comments). Of course, it may have shifted in a more positive direction for IU's good image, but it gave the awareness that it is an act that causes great harm to others. Since then, I feel somewhat protected." In the midst of a controversy over the similarity of lightsticks between QWER and THE BOYZ, QWER's Shiyon criticized malicious comments, urging for respectful dialogue. Both groups are in conflict over the design issue, with QWER defending their lightstick's originality while THE BOYZ seeks legal action. The Korean Entertainment Producers Association has stepped in to mediate the situation.
The Korean Management Union has officially addressed the issue of similarity between THE BOYZ and QWER light sticks, expressing deep concern. They emphasize the importance of unique symbols for fandoms and call for cooperation between the respective agencies to resolve the matter and maintain healthy K-POP culture.
The Korean Entertainment Producers Association has issued a statement regarding the design similarities between THE BOYZ and QWER's official lightsticks, stressing the importance of creativity, mutual respect, and the potential impact on K-POP culture and fandom communities. They call for balanced consideration of legal issues and the need for industry-wide agreements to protect intellectual property.

THE BOYZ's overseas concerts scheduled for October 11 in Macau and October 25 in Taipei have been canceled due to local circumstances. Their agency, One Hundred, apologized for the sudden notice and stated that all ticket purchases will be automatically refunded. They also confirmed no additional shows will be added after Jakarta, emphasizing their commitment to complete the tour successfully and apologizing for the inconvenience caused to fans.
THE BOYZ's agency, One Hundred, has apologized for the confusion caused by the design similarities between their official light stick and QWER's. They acknowledge the importance of light sticks as symbols connecting artists and fans, and they are committed to preventing future issues through legal measures and careful attention to fan feedback.
